Following the first Gulf War in 1991, Iraq issued new currency that was used until Saddam Hussein was thrown from power in 2003. Now you can own this historic collection that includes three emergency bank notes issued right after the first Gulf War, plus eight bank notes featuring Saddam's portrait and themes of cultural importance. Due to the war in Iraq, crisp uncirculated Iraqi Dinar like those found in this 11-note set issued by the Central Bank of Iraq are rapidly disappearing, often mishandled and becoming increasingly rare as most were destroyed when new bank notes were printed without Saddam's portrait in 2003.
